The Board of Directors of LIAT has appointed an acting Chief Executive Officer.
She is Julie Reifer-Jones.
Her appointment follows the resignation of Chief Executive Officer, Ian Brunton effective October 1, 2013.
The Board of Directors of the regional airline thanked Brunton for his service. (PR)
